Floor repair method
Abstract
A repair method for repairing a floor, the floor consisting of a cover stratum and a base stratum, the cover stratum having an upper surface and a lower surface, the base stratum having an upper surface, the lower surface of the cover stratum being fixedly attached to the upper surface of the base stratum, the cover stratum having a damaged area, the damaged area consisting of an aperture having an upper and a lower end, the aperture extending from the upper surface of the cover stratum to the lower surface of the cover stratum, the repair method comprising the steps of painting a section of the upper surface of the base stratum, the section painted spanning across the lower end of the aperture; pouring filler into the aperture; and, pouring adhesive into the filler.

1. A repair method for repairing a floor, the floor comprising a cover stratum and a base stratum, the cover stratum having an upper surface and a lower surface, the base stratum having an upper surface, the cover stratum having a damaged area, the damaged area comprising an aperture, the aperture having a side wall, an upper end, and a lower end, the aperture extending from the upper surface of the cover stratum to the lower surface of the cover stratum, the repair method comprising the steps of: (a) painting a section of the upper surface of the base stratum, the section painted spanning across the lower end of the aperture; (b) pouring filler into the aperture; and, (c) pouring adhesive into the filler.
2. The repair method of claim 1, wherein the step of pouring filler comprises selecting a material from the group consisting of sodium bicarbonate powder, calcium carbonate powder, silica powder, and corn starch powder.
3. The repair method of claim 1, wherein the step of pouring adhesive comprises selecting a liquid from the group consisting of methyl based cyanoacrylate ester adhesives and or ethyl based cyanoacrylate adhesives.
4. The method of claim 1, wherein the step of painting the section of the upper surface of the base stratum comprises selecting a liquid from the group consisting of light colored tempera paints, light colored latex paints, and light colored enamel paints.
5. The repair method of claim 4, further comprising the step of trimming the side wall of the aperture, such step being performed prior to the painting step.
6. The repair method of claim 5, further comprising the step of sanding the wall of the aperture, such step being performed prior to the painting step.
7. The repair method of claim 6, further comprising the step of troweling the filler to form an upper filler surface co-extensive with the upper surface of the cover stratum, such troweling step being performed prior to the step of pouring adhesive.
8. The repair method of claim 7, further comprising the step of drying the filler, such step being performed after the step of pouring adhesive.
9. The repair method of claim 8, further comprising the step of sanding the upper filler surface, such step being performed after the drying step.
10. The method of claim 1, wherein the step of painting the section of the upper surface of the base stratum comprises selecting a liquid from the group consisting of water based tempera paints, and water based latex paints.
11. The repair method of claim 10, further comprising the step of trimming the side wall of the aperture, such step being performed prior to the painting step.
12. The repair method of claim 11, further comprising the step of sanding the wall of the aperture, such step being performed prior to the painting step.
13. The repair method of claim 12, further comprising the step of troweling the filler to form an upper filler surface co-extensive with the upper surface of the cover stratum, such troweling step being performed prior to the step of pouring adhesive.
